We closed on a no season refinanced deal today. It took longer than what I hoped it would take but the deal is closed now.

As many of you know we bought a house in Indiana for 15k back in October. We had new carpet put in new doors and windows, new furnace, and bathroom remodeled plus paint though out the house and some electrical work done. All the work done for about 20k. We had the house appraised for 61k in December. The repair work took a little longer but it was done right.

Now we have a check coming to us for 45k minus the bank fees for the loan. UP DATE as of 02/12/11 the check is in our account.

I would like to thank Dean and Matt Larson for telling us about small town banks that will do a no season loan. We learned about this by watching the 2010 Edge DVDs.

One thing I would like to add is we had to register our California LLC in Indiana before the bank would give us the loan in our LLC name. I do not know if other DGers doing out of state deals have had to do this also but if any one is planning on getting a loan for their LLC in another state make sure you do your home work.

GMAC loan that is great. What we had to do was get a letter of good standing rom California SOS. Send that and $90.00 to the SOS of Indiana with the paper work you can get on line at the SOS web site and that was it.

Well, the loan didn't go through, but it wasn't because of the seasoning, it was because they took, we found out, 70% of our rents, instead of 75% of them Their DTI ratio acceptance is very high (65%!), BUT, they remove 30% of your rental income, so that means my income went down almost $3K per month, DESPITE 3 of my properties being rented long term since 2004 with NO vacancies!

How they do it? Well, I'm dealing with a lender who does direct lending. They fund the loan and have the flexibility to take loans that don't meet the standard requirements. Then, they IMMEDIATELY sell them off, to big banks. GMAC will BUY no season loans, but they won't ORIGINATE no season loans. Wish I could have closed on that one.
